The holiday's for Kirby and I are always a fun time of the year as we get to spend extra time with our families.  Seeing that we don't have any children we seem to do all the running while it is a little tiring it is well worth it.  We spent Thanksgiving with the Melchi family (my parents and my sisters family) at my parents house and Kirby's parents joined us there, it was nice to be all together for the holiday.  Kirby and I are so thankful to have such a wonderful family which includes both sides. 

The day after Thanksgiving we did our annual Christmas Tree hunt with the Bird family.  We first met for breakfast then it is off to Fairview Tree Farm to get our tree.  The owner lets my dad driver the tractor and the rest of us pile on the wagon and off we go into the field.  It was very cold and windy this year so Sam the littlest of the group rode in the nice warm truck with his dad.  We had a great time finding our trees, I believe we ended up with five for the group this year.  It is such a lovely holiday tradition.

To bring some holiday spirit to our holiday season we attended Andrew's holiday band concert and Sydney's choir concert.  It is great to see them both taking part in the arts and enjoying it.  Kirby and I also went to my parents one Saturday night and made Christmas cookies.  It is a tradition in the Melchi family to make Christmas cookies.  We have been doing it since I was a young girl.  I can remember having my friends over when I was younger to help out.  We would end up with the sugar cookie dough on the bottom of our socks and the dough everywhere.  I'm not sure how my mom did not get mad at us but we sure did have fun.  Over the years there have been a lot of people that have taken part in this tradition but this year it was Kirby, My Mom, My Dad and I.  Mainly my dad and I did it while Kirby and my mom told us how to do it :) we had a good time though.  Plus the cookies turned out very well.

NYC/US Open

Back the early part of September, Kirby and I took our annual trip to New York City.  Well it used to be annual but then we took a couple years off because we got married one year then the next year a friend of ours got married.  But last winter Kirby and I decided we were going to start making the trip again.  Our main reason for going is to attend the US Open Tennis Tournament.  See both Kirby and I played tennis growing up and have a love for the game.  Then when we were dating we got talking about things we would like to do before we die (like you do when you are dating, telling the other person all your hopes and dream :)) and it turned out that we both had attending the US Open on our "bucket list".  So that first year of dating off to the US Open we went and had a great time. 

Now fast forward to September 2012 (five years later).  As I said our main reason for going is to attend the US Open but while we are there we take in the sights of New York City.  This year besides seeing great tennis and great tennis players we also went to the 911 Memorial and Museum, saw the Enterprise shuttle which is now located on the USS Intreprid and did a lot of walking around.  I think one of the highlights of the trip for us was that we got to see Andy Roddick play as this was the last tournament he played in.  We had a very nice trip and enjoyed our time in "The Big Apple".  Here are some of the pictures from our trip!
